			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Choosing where to go in Las Vegas is a very difficult task to accomplish. There is just too much going on in the Sin City which is the capital of gambling, entertainment, and shopping.</p>
<p>We can trim down the list to Las Vegas’ most popular tourist attractions:</p>
<h4>Mount Charleston</h4>
<p>Around 35 miles from the city proper, you can find this body of land where it is always colder by 30 degrees. The spot is perfect for horseback riding or camping during the summer. When winter strikes, the place is a haven for skiers and snow board enthusiasts.</p>
<h4>Valley of Fire</h4>
<p>The Valley of Fire is about 50 miles northeast of the Sin City. The valley is made up of around 26000 acres of desert. The harshness of the environment has been immortalized in post cards and Hollywood films. One can also see the wondrous stone formation carved by the strong winds and the sand.</p>
<h4>Bryce Canyon</h4>
<p>This is a declared national park. Four hours away from Las Vegas, the Bryce Canyon features ravines rather than the canyon formation.  Most tourists are mesmerized with a stunning view.</p>
<h4>Ash Meadows</h4>
<p>Located in the Ashmorga Valley, the Ashe Meadows consist of spring wet lands and portions of deserts. The environment boasts of 20 animals that can only be seen this part of the world.</p>
<h4>Grand Canyon</h4>
<p>About 100 miles to the east of the Sin City, the Grand Canyon never fails to please the crowd and the cameras. A lot of group tours are organized here including white water rafting, air ballooning, or helicopter rides over the canyon.</p>
